Mixtecs, Zapotecs, and Chatinos: Ancient Peoples of SouthernMexico examines the origins, history, and interrelationships ofthe civilizations that arose and flourished in Oaxaca.
* Provides an up-to-date summary of the current state ofresearch findings and archaeological evidence
* Uses contemporary social theory to address many key problemsrelating to archaeology of the Americas, including the dynamics ofsocial life and the rise and fall of civilizations
* Adds clarity to ongoing debates over cultural change andinterregional interactions in ancient Mesoamerican societies
* Supplemented with compelling illustrations, photographs, andline drawings of various archaeological sites and artifacts

Arthur A. Joyce is Associate Professor of Anthropology at the University of Colorado at Boulder. He has a Ph.D. from Rutgers University and has carried out field research in Oaxaca since 1986. His current research interests include social theory in archaeology, human ecology, and the origins, development, and collapse of complex societies in Mesoamerica.
